Understand the Concrete Mix


The first step to mastering concrete work is understanding the material you're working with. Different projects require different concrete mixtures. For instance, a sidewalk requires a different mix than a countertop. Knowing the right proportions of cement, sand, and aggregate for your specific project can make a significant difference in the final outcome.


Proper Curing is Key


Curing is a critical step in the concrete crafting process that's often overlooked. It's not just about letting the concrete dry; it's about allowing it to gain strength over time. Make sure to keep the concrete moist and adequately protected for at least a week after pouring. This allows the cement to hydrate properly, resulting in a stronger and more durable product.
